Front End Engineer - Aurora/RDS, RDS Console

Come and change the way our customers interact with relational database solutions at scale!

AWS Aurora/RDS is one of the fastest-growing AWS businesses, providing super-simple provisioning and management for relational databases in the cloud. Customers can set up a new database with just a few clicks, and complex administrative tasks like scaling, fail-over, and monitoring are all handled in an automated fashion by our control systems.


Key job responsibilities
As a front end development engineer in the RDS Console team in Dublin, you will get to design, develop and deploy quality solutions that help external and internal customers interface with the RDS service at scale via graphical interfaces.

Our team puts a high value on work-life balance. Most days, our team is co-located in the Dublin offices. We generally keep core in-office hours from 10am to 4pm and provide flexibility for people to structure their working hours around them.

The position involves on-call responsibilities, typically once every 4 to 5 weeks. We don’t like getting paged in the middle of the night or on the weekend, so we prioritise the constant improvement of the operational posture of the solutions we own. When we do get paged, we work together to first mitigate and then resolve the root cause so we don’t get paged for the same issue twice.

Basic Qualifications - Experience (non-internship) in professional front end, web or mobile software development using JavaScript, HTML and CSS
- Experience in computer science fundamentals (object-oriented design, data structures, algorithm design, problem solving and complexity analysis)
- Experience using JavaScript frameworks such as angular and react
- Experience in agile software development methodology
- Experience building reusable UX components or libraries Preferred Qualifications - Bachelor's degree in computer science or equivalent
